Summary
Bin Wang is an AI research scientist based in Singapore with eight years of experience at the intersection of multimodal machine learning, natural language processing, and AI system evaluation. As a current AI Research Scientist at MiroMind.ai, he focuses on bridging human intelligence and AI, contributing as an AGI contributor and advancing multimodal capabilities. Previously at the Institute for Infocomm Research, he led evaluation for the MERaLiON project (a $70M NRF‑funded initiative) and co-led multimodal data collection, helping to train large-scale models on 100+ GPUs and open-sourcing tools like MERaLiON-AudioLLM, AudioBench, SeaEval, and the Multitask National Speech Corpus. His academic tenure includes roles at the National University of Singapore and USC Ming Hsieh Institute, where he worked on NLP, ML and DL, and supervised/mentored students. He holds a PhD and MS in Electrical Engineering from USC and a bachelor's from UESTC, reflecting a strong foundation in both theory and deployment. He has deep hands-on experience across research, education, and industry, and is actively contributing to Singapore’s first multimodal LLM ecosystem.
